- double型变量是双精度浮点数,占用8个字节的内存空间,能够存储更大范围的数值,精度更高,通常用于需要更高精度计算的场景。
- double型变量的取值范围为±1.7E-308~±1.7E+308,可精确到15位有效数字。
- double型变量在计算时可能会引入舍入误差,需要注意精度丢失的问题。
- double型变量的运算速度通常比float型变量慢,但精度更高。
- double型变量可以用科学计数法表示,如1.23E10表示1.23乘以10的10次方。
c语言double型变量有哪些特点
推荐文章
-
c语言的常量有哪些
在C语言中,常量可以分为以下几种: 整型常量:如123,-456等;
浮点型常量:如3.14,-0.5等;
字符常量:用单引号括起来的单个字符,如’a’,'1’等... -
c语言时钟代码怎么编写
????????C????????:
#include #include int main() { time_t rawtime; struct tm * timeinfo; time(&rawtime); timeinfo = localtime(&rawtime); printf("C... -
c语言三角形代码怎么编写
下面是一个简单的C语言程序,用于打印一个等边三角形:
#include int main() { int i, j, rows; printf("Enter the number of rows: "); scanf("%d", &rows... -
c语言字符串是什么
在C语言中,字符串是一组以空字符’\0’结尾的字符序列,通常被用来表示文本数据。字符串在C语言中是以字符数组的形式存储的,可以通过字符数组的方式来操作和处...
-
c语言double型变量怎么转换
在C语言中,double类型的变量可以通过强制类型转换来转换为其他数据类型。例如,将double类型转换为int类型可以使用以下语法:
double num = 3.14;
in... -
怎么用Python输入n个整数求和
可以使用下面的代码来输入n个整数并求和:
n = int(input("输入整数个数:"))
total = 0 for i in range(n): num = int(input("输入第{}个整数:".for... -
pgsql中nullif函数的用法是什么
在 PostgreSQL 中,nullif 函数用于比较两个值,并返回第一个参数值,如果两个参数相等,则返回 NULL。其语法如下:
nullif(expression1, expression2) 其中... -
sql中decimal的作用是什么
在SQL中,DECIMAL是一种数据类型,用于存储精确的十进制数值。它通常用于存储货币金额或其他需要精确计算的数值,因为DECIMAL类型不会丢失精度。DECIMAL类型需要...